AU-C 560 Subsequent Events and Subsequently Discovered Facts

AU-C Original Pronouncement

Source Statement on Auditing Standards (SAS) 122.

Definitions of Terms

Source: AU-C 560.07

  1. Date of the auditor's report. The date that the auditor dates the report on the financial statements, in accordance with Section 700 (Ref: par. .A14).
  2. Date of the financial statements. The date of the end of the latest period covered by the financial statements.
  3. Subsequent events. Events occurring between the date of the financial statements and the date of the auditor's report.
  4. Subsequently discovered facts. Facts that become known to the auditor after the date of the auditor's report that, had they been known to the auditor at that date, may have caused the auditor to revise the auditor's report.

Objectives of AU-C Section 560

AU-C Section 560.05 states that:

…the objectives of the auditor are to

  1. obtain sufficient appropriate audit evidence about whether events occurring between the date of the financial statements and the date of the auditor's report that require adjustment of, or disclosure in, the financial statements are appropriately reflected in those financial statements in accordance with the applicable financial reporting framework and
  2. respond appropriately to facts that become known to the auditor after the date of the auditor's report that, had they been known to the auditor at that date, may have caused the auditor to revise the auditor's report.
